New Energy Wind Power Introduction
Wind power is a sustainable, renewable energy source, and has a much smaller impact on the environment than burning fossil fuels. Historically, wind power was used by sails, windmills and windpumps, but today it is mostly used to generate electricity. Yemen solar power generation for home use new energy generation for home use
Yemen, widely regarded as the Middle East's least electrified nation, is now benefiting from its first large-scale solar plant, which is helping restore power to tens of thousands of households in Aden. The Aden Solar Power Plant, a 120-megawatt facility funded by the United Arab Emirates, began. . Over 152 public service facilities, including schools, healthcare centres, and local administration offices, have received solar energy equipment since 2023, benefiting 199,745 individuals (including 16,175 women) and allowing public services to resume critical functions in difficult times.
